Output 955eba66e100c4d9b8af78c2587cfaccf9ae3c96088e96c8284016112eac23f1:2

value
10834391
script pubkey
OP_0 OP_PUSHBYTES_20 fbeb75421a74063594fa81d84ea2dec4e0281ef9
address
bc1ql04h2ss6wsrrt986s8vyagk7cnszs8hejychvz
transaction
955eba66e100c4d9b8af78c2587cfaccf9ae3c96088e96c8284016112eac23f1
spent
true